ABSTRACT:
The present invention is directed to condensation products of amino substituted nitrogen heterocycles, such as pyridines, with unsaturated carboxylic acids as well as their sulfurization products. It has been found that additive amounts of such condensation reaction products when incorporated into lubricant compositions provide effective anti-rust properties against, for example, salt water corrosion.
